@kdramarama
Attorney Woo was really great and I'm looking really looking forward for the second season.
The Glory was a bit too grim for me, but I did finish it.
Stranger and Goblin I did like both.

My recommendations would be
- Sky Castle (the first episode is a bit boring, but ends with a bang and after that I could not stop watching and it become one of my all time favourites)
- Search WWW (good plot, bautifully framed and shot, excellent music)
- Start-Up (also interesting plot and high production quality, contains one of the most ridiculously funny moments few dramas after it have referenced)
- It's Ok Not To Be OK (the female lead character is quite bad representation, which have turned some off, but otherwise very touching and fun and Moon Sang-tae (played by Oh Jung-se) is one of the best represented autistic characters)
